The Director of Product Management is responsible for delivering business value to drive sales, increase efficiency, and improve customer satisfaction through the development of quality technology products. Within their designated enterprise product portfolio, the Director focuses on delivering value by leading the strategic vision and product roadmap across the customer journey, ensuring all products within their portfolio are aligned to this vision, and communicating the product vision across all levels of the organization. The Director is responsible for driving stakeholder alignment, managing interdependencies with other products within the customer journey, supporting all planning, development, and delivery efforts, and is responsible for attracting, motivating, coaching, and mentoring top product management talent at the Home Depot.


The Director of Product Management, Merchandising Execution and In-Store Environment is responsible for the development and implementation of technology products for the broader MET and ISE organizations. This position will oversee the creation and implementation of innovative technology aimed at enabling and driving efficiency for more than 20K Home Depot associates. This role will work closely with the MET leadership team to align on strategic priorities and solutions that meet business needs.
